Course Content

• Introduction to Inclusive Urban Green Infrastructure: Principles and Practices
• Planning and Design for Accessible Green Spaces: Universal Design & Sensory Gardens
• Sustainable Stormwater Management in Urban Environments: Green Infrastructure Solutions
• Biodiversity and Ecosystem Services in Urban Green Infrastructure: Pollinator Habitats and Green Roofs
• Community Engagement and Social Inclusion in Urban Greening Projects: Participatory Design & Equity
• Implementing and Maintaining Inclusive Green Infrastructure: Case Studies and Best Practices
• Financing and Policy for Inclusive Urban Green Infrastructure: Funding Models and Regulations
• Monitoring and Evaluation of Inclusive Green Infrastructure: Impact Assessment and Sustainability

Career path

Career Opportunities in Inclusive Urban Green Infrastructure (UK)

Career Role Description
Urban Green Infrastructure Designer Develops and implements sustainable urban green space designs, prioritizing inclusivity and accessibility. High demand for expertise in sustainable drainage systems (SuDS).
Ecologist / Biodiversity Consultant Assesses the ecological impact of urban green infrastructure projects and advises on biodiversity enhancement strategies. Focus on green infrastructure planning and ecological restoration.
Green Infrastructure Project Manager Manages the delivery of green infrastructure projects, from initial design to completion, ensuring projects are delivered on time and within budget. Experience in community engagement crucial.
Sustainability Consultant (Green Infrastructure Focus) Provides expert advice on integrating green infrastructure into urban planning and development, promoting sustainable and resilient cities. Strong knowledge of environmental regulations needed.
Urban Horticulturalist / Arborist Specializes in the selection, planting, and maintenance of trees and plants within urban green spaces, considering ecological and social needs. Extensive knowledge of plant species and their management.
